Re: VB6 APP on a Cloud Server
 Originally Posted by DllHell
If the goal is to be able to access the app from anywhere, the users can simply remote into their desktops and use the app, or any other app, on their pc. It seems like a no-brainer first step. You would still have to keep the local db server and you woundn't use any cloud computers.
Oh, i understand what you mean. I live in a 3rd world country where electricity is available on an average of 4 hours every day. Keeping their local system on 24/7 as required would mean having it on inverters and that is very expensive. Thats why we have the APP on a cloud server where it is guaranteed to be online always and they can login to APP any day and any time.
But having all the 20 users to access the APP on cloud server using RDP now is the next big challenge.
